NSF EPSCoR E-CORE: Funding to improve state research ecosystems and core infrastructure

NSF’s EPSCoR Research Infrastructure Improvement Program (E-CORE) funds partnerships that help eligible jurisdictions strengthen and sustain research infrastructure. Projects focus on building “cores” such as cyberinfrastructure, research facilities, workforce and STEM pathways, broadening participation, community engagement, technology transfer, and national or global partnerships.
